Message type: E = Error
Message class: HRPAYDEAO - Data Access Tax Audit
Message number: 022
Message text: Error while opening TemSe file &1
The specified TemSe file could not be opened.
The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.
Use SP11 to check that the file you are searching for exists.

The SAP error message HRPAYDEAO022, which indicates "Error while opening TemSe file &1," typically occurs in the context of payroll processing or when accessing temporary storage files (TemSe) in the SAP system. Here’s a breakdown of the potential causes, solutions, and related information for this error: Causes: File Corruption: The TemSe file may be corrupted or damaged, preventing it from being opened. File Locking: The file might be locked by another process or user, which can lead to access issues. Insufficient Authorizations: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to access the TemSe file. Database Issues: There could be underlying database issues affecting the storage and retrieval of TemSe files.
